Focusing on the evolution of the modern British state, this political history examines its increasing interest in gathering and utilizing population data. It explores the implications of this data collection on governance and societal understanding, highlighting the significance of demographic information in shaping policies and national identity. Through detailed analysis, the book sheds light on how population statistics have influenced the development of modern Britain.
